New measure to benefit tax dodgersThe government is offering amnesty to all tax dodgers, even those under investigation by prosecuting authorities, therefore writing off very serious tax crimes that normally get punished with huge fines and jail terms between 10 and 20 years.The new bill provides for immunity from any legal action over illegal incomes that will be declared. Foreign bank account holders who legalize their funds in that fashion will not even have to repatriate their capital.

James Bond: Pussy Galore returns in new novelPussy Galore is to be reunited with James Bond in the superspy's latest literary outing.Ian Fleming's famous leading lady is back in Anthony Horowitz's new official Bond novel, Trigger Mortis. Horowitz's prolific output includes the teen spy series, Alex Rider, which has sold more than 19 million copies.He has written two official Sherlock Holmes novels - The House of Silk and Moriarty - and as a TV screenwriter he created Midsomer Murders, Foyle's War and Crime Traveller.
